you might have noticed a slight chill in the air, but did you know a freeze is about to roll into town?
whoa, whoa, slow your role… there’s no need to pack your bags for warmer climes! this isn’t a warning about an imminent ice age, we’re talking about something a thousand times more exciting – the relentless freeze festival 2010!
that’s right, three days of snowboard, ski and music mayhem will once again take over london’s battersea power station on the 29th of october, with festivities promising to top previous years. adrenaline hungry revellers are in for a real treat, as the worlds best skiers and snowboarders take centre stage, around the focal point of a 32m high, 100m long real snow jump.
and what’s an extreme sports event without some massive tunes thrown in for good measure? well freeze doesn’t disappoint, with a mighty line up including the likes of mark ronson, pendulum, and bedouin soundclash!
